Today was also the perfect time to try out these star studs I received from Born Pretty Store. If I was going to try 3D studs they had to be in my favorite star shapes. Luckily, they were available in the 2mm size which were small enough for my tiny little nail stubs! I wouldn’t name these particularly RA-friendly as I had to use tweezers to turn them right side up but after that they applied without further hassle. They fell off the nail more easily than the Fimo canes. The bottom is slightly hollowed out so if I apply these with normal top coat application there is less surface area to adhere to the nail. However, they did hold up to light normal finger movement. If I remember to remove them properly the pieces are definitely re-usable. Though, I imagine I will lose quite a few too as I knocked a few out of the tin without realizing it!
